Julia CASTONYAR was born abt. 1836

Julia CASTONYAR was the child of ?   and   ?

Julia was a Native American/First Nation.

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Julia  married  Bruno HUS COURNOYER abt. 1851 in Sioux City, Iowa, USA .  The couple had (at least) 2 children.
Bruno HUS COURNOYER  was born 20 March 1821 in Sorel, Québec, Canada (Saint-Pierre).  Bruno died 2 October 1902 in South Dakota, USA.  Bruno was the child of Pierre HUS COURNOYER and Marie-Anne SALVAIL.

Julia CASTONYAR died abt. 1855 in Nebraska Territory.
